Background technology
With the exploitation of the extensive land resource of China, pile foundation turns into the main supporting body of all kinds of engineering constructions, it It is widely used in the fields such as skyscraper, highway bridge, wind power foundation.Pile foundation is in addition to vertical load is born, in many situations Under (for example, earthquake load, wind load, neighbouring preloading, it is neighbouring excavate, bank protection is reinforced etc.) still suffer from certain horizontal loading. Cast-in-situ bored pile is used widely with its easy construction, high capacity.In recent years, the quickening of urbanization process and environment control The high severization of system, the bearing safety stabilization to pile foundation proposes higher requirement.The mechanism and design of pile foundation vertical carrying are applied Work is close to maturing, and the consideration on horizontal bearing performance turns into the key element of influence buildings or structures safety and effectivity.Pile foundation Horizontal bearing is mainly controlled by a range of soil layer in top, and the non-linear of the soil body, layering, elastoplasticity are piles under lateral load Where the difficult point of design.To improve pile foundation level bearing capacity, conventional method is mainly by increasing stake footpath, and increase pile body itself is firm Degree, or the measures such as local stiffening are carried out come what is realized to Pile side soil body, often cost is too high for such way, and efficiency is low, and It should not construct on a large scale.In terms of modern pile foundation development, also concentrate on to improve the novel pile that vertical bearing capacity is researched and developed mostly Base, including support disk pile, bamboo joint pile, wedge pile, the stake of Y types etc..Above abnormal shape pile foundation is also right while vertical bearing capacity is lifted The lifting of pile foundation level bearing capacity has been contributed, but is the problem of exist, and these pile-type must rely on special construction equipment, construction Complex operation, pile quality is also relatively difficult to ensure card.
The content of the invention
Goal of the invention:For bored concrete pile horizontal bearing safety problem, the present invention provides a kind of special, targetedly soft Soil base bored concrete pile horizontal bearing reinforcement and its construction method.
Technical scheme:To achieve the above object, the technical solution adopted by the present invention is:
A kind of soft soil foundation bored concrete pile horizontal bearing reinforcement, including the wing plate of one group of structure and size all same and one Hoop, wing plate is evenly arranged on the week side of boss of hoop, wing plate and is provided with aperture;The wing plate be class fillet trapezoid, wing plate it is short While being provided with neck, the double wedge consistent with wing plate quantity is circumferentially evenly arranged with hoop, passes through card between wing plate and hoop The gap of groove and double wedge coordinates realization to be hinged;When not by external force, the wing plate freely hangs, and wing plate can be real with respect to hoop Rotation in the range of existing 90 °, i.e.,:Wing plate upper surface make it that wing plate is inside by downward pressure, is rotated down, when rotation is to most During big position, the angle of wing plate and hoop vertical plane is designated as α, 0≤α≤5 °;Wing plate lower surface is upwarded pressure so that the wing Plate is outside, rotate up, and when rotation is to maximum position, the angle of wing plate and hoop vertical plane is designated as β;α<β≤90°.
Specifically, when the angle of wing plate and hoop vertical plane is α, there is overlap joint between adjacent two panels wing plate;Faying surface Product is more than the 1/4 of monolithic area of foil, and preferably overlapping area is 1/3.
Specifically, when the angle of wing plate and hoop vertical plane is β, overlap joint is still suffered between adjacent two panels wing plate.
Specifically, the hoop is the structure of two sections of semi-rings, rotatable hinge is realized in one end of two sections of semi-rings by rivet Connect, the other end of two sections of semi-rings realizes dismountable connection by latch.
Specifically, being provided with ribbing muscle on the wing plate.
A kind of construction method of soft soil foundation bored concrete pile horizontal bearing reinforcement, comprises the following steps:
Step1:Release latch connection, hoop open in the case of, wing plate is installed on hoop, check wing plate around The rotation situation of hoop, it is ensured that mutual overlap joint and synchronization between adjacent vanes open, being condensed property;
Step2:Hoop and wing plate are integrally enclosed and are suspended on steel reinforcement cage, the connection of latch is closed, while by iron wire by ring Colligation is bound round to the cage bar of steel reinforcement cage;
Step3:Hoop, wing plate and steel reinforcement cage are integrally transferred into drilling specified location, under after the completion of steel reinforcement cage is disposed Put Grouting Pipe;
Step4:The slip casting into drilling by Grouting Pipe, slurries from slip casting bottom of the tube to Grouting Pipe outside outflow and back up Rise, wing plate opens under the uplift pressure that slurries go up, into umbrella shaped support in drilling;
Step5:Continue slip casting, the wing plate of vertically arranged all different depths is all opened;
Step6:Slip casting terminates, and all wing plates and hoop are finally wrapped up by slurries to be solidified, and is collectively forming and is conducive to pile foundation water The reinforced-concrete reinforcement of flat carrying.
Specifically, in view of pile foundation level carrying is controlled primarily by top a range of pile-soil interaction influence, because This described wing plate can be arranged only in the range of 5 times of bore diameters on pile foundation top.
Beneficial effect:Soft soil foundation bored concrete pile horizontal bearing reinforcement and its construction method that the present invention is provided, are solved Long-standing bored concrete pile horizontal bearing capacity lifting is wasted with the single cost brought by increase stake footpath and special-shaped pile foundation again must Contradiction between must being equipped by special construction;The inventive method is collectively forming level using wing plate, hoop and grouting concrete and held Reinforcement is carried, the lifting of bored concrete pile horizontal bearing capacity is realized, vertical bearing capacity is also enhanced, and without specific pile foundation construction dress Standby, installation method is simple, efficient quick.
